B2D pre-allocation not working. Disk still fragmenting

We have enabled the regedit described in Hotfix 27 (which is included in SP3), but have not seen a change in this issue.  Current B2D files were deleted and the remainder of the disk was defragmented.  The regedit for H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\VERITAS\Adamm\   DWORD "PreAllocate"=1 was added on BE server referencing http://seer.support.veritas.com/docs/283264.htm. And server has been rebooted.  However, the remote B2D drive is still becoming fragmented.

Does anyone know if this pre-allocation functions across the network vs being direct attached storage?  I would still think windows could create pre-allocated files across a network, but cannot find references either way.

Server 2003 SP2 running Backup Exec 10.1 (d) build 5629 SP3 installed.  Destination folder for the B2D files is on server 2000.
